It's blackgaze?not much more to say. However, as someone who pretty much despises the genre, a 7 from me is probably close to a 10 from anyone else. Plenty of emotions here and I was able to sit through the whole thing. Not much variety, but enough energy to keep it from becoming completely boring.
Enjoyability=7
Musicianship=7
Innovation=7
Overall=7

Found myself very pleasantly surprised with this album, just as much as the previous record "Try Not to Destroy Everything You Love". Whilst I still prefer that album by a margin, "The Long Goodbye" still has many golden moments which I never tire of. I think there's a more simplistic approach generally in regards to the songwriting side of things, but the momentum and consistency throughout is kept at a very high level, making for a fluent record if not an overly complex one. My personal highlight would be 'Endless Skies', but I couldn't really find any filler material here so every song is as useful as the next.
